The process of files being corrupted owing to some hardware or software failure is called data corruption and this is among the main problems which Internet hosting companies face as the larger a hard drive is and the more data is filed on it, the more likely it is for data to be corrupted. You'll find different fail-safes, yet often the info gets damaged silently, so neither the file system, nor the administrators see a thing. As a result, a damaged file will be treated as a good one and if the hard drive is part of a RAID, the file will be copied on all other drives. In principle, this is for redundancy, but in practice the damage will get even worse. Once a given file gets damaged, it will be partially or entirely unreadable, therefore a text file will no longer be readable, an image file will show a random mix of colors in case it opens at all and an archive will be impossible to unpack, and you risk sacrificing your website content. Although the most commonly used server file systems include various checks, they are likely to fail to discover some problem early enough or require an extensive amount of time in order to check all the files and the hosting server will not be operational in the meantime.
